While the majority of Individual retirement accounts invest in standard assets like stocks or mutual funds, the tax code also permits special "self-directed" or "alternative-asset" IRAs that can hold physical silver or gold. However not all valuable metals are allowed. 401k to gold rollover no penalty. In reality, the law names particular gold, silver and platinum coins that certify like the American Gold Eagle and defines purity standards for gold, silver, platinum or palladium bars in such accounts.

The tax code likewise states the gold or silver should be held by an IRS-approved custodian or trustee, though some gold Individual Retirement Account online marketers declare there's a loophole in this law (more about this later). But the proof is blended on whether owning gold can really keep your cost savings safe. For starters, while gold can supply some insurance against inflation, just just how much depends upon your timing and perseverance. "Gold does tend to hold its worth in the long-term, however it is also unpredictable roughly as volatile as stocks so you may require years to ride out its ups and downs," states Campbell Harvey, the J.

" So gold would be at the bottom of the list for people who are retired or close to retirement." From 1981 through 2000, for instance, when inflation almost doubled, gold went more or less sideways. Then in this century, the metal truly removed - 401k gold ira rollover. It increased by more than 500% from January 2000 (when it traded at around $280 per ounce) to a high of approximately $1,900 in August 2011, while inflation climbed up only 34%. Because then, however, gold has fallen by about a third in worth, to around $1,270 an ounce in mid-June, while inflation edged up 8%.

The POINTERS comparison raises one essential difference in between rare-earth elements and other financial investments: they have no earnings stream, such as the interest on a bond or dividends from a stock, to cushion their price swings. What's more, precious metals have considerable purchase and holding expenses that stocks and bonds don't share. For starters, there are base fees and storage expenses. At Rosland Capital, you'll pay a one-time $50 fee to open an account and around $225 a year to store and guarantee your holdings at a safe depository in northern Delaware.

However they make that cash back on a much more considerable cost: the "spread," or gap in between the wholesale rate the company pays to acquire the metal and the retail cost it charges you as a purchaser. Lear Capital, for example, recently used an IRA Perk Program that picked up $500 of costs for consumers who purchased least $50,000 in silver or gold. However the company's Transaction Arrangement said the spread on coins and bullion sold to IRA customers "typically" varied between 17 and 33%. So if the spread were 17%, a client who opened a $50,000 IRA would pay $8,500 for the spread and get just $41,500 in wholesale-value gold which left lots of margin for Lear to recoup that $500 bonus offer.

If you offer the gold or silver to a third-party dealer, you might lose money on another spread, since dealerships normally want to pay less than what they think they can get for the metal on the open market (united gold direct - ira/401k gold rollover). To help customers avoid that hazard, some IRA companies will redeem your gold at, state, the then-prevailing wholesale rate. Even so, thanks to the initial spread our theoretical investor paid to open her $50,000 Individual Retirement Account, she would need gold prices to increase by over 20% simply to recover cost. Compare that to the cost of a traditional IRA, where opening and closing an account is frequently totally free and transactions may cost just $8 per trade.

Tax concerns aside, economists state there is a far more cost-effective method to include gold to your retirement portfolio: invest in an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F) that tracks the price of the metal. These funds like SPDR Gold Shares, IShares Gold Trust, ETFS Physical Swiss Gold Shares and others are basically trusts that own large quantities of gold bullion - solo 401k gold rollover. SPDR Gold, for instance, has almost $34 billion in gold bars embeded a giant underground vault in London where employees in titanium-toed shoes drive the stuff around on forklifts.

There's no minimum financial investment other than the expense of a single share, which recently varied from around $5 to approximately $120, depending on the ETF. And since the funds purchase and store gold wholesale, their business expenses are relatively low (best 401k rollover for gold and silver). SPDR Gold's annual costs are topped at 4/10 of a percent of holdings each year, for instance, or somewhere in between the expense of an index fund and an actively managed fund. For many financiers, the appeal of valuable metals is difficult to resistmost significantly, gold. It is one of the most sought-after and popular investments on the planet because it can use profitable returns in any financial investment portfolio. Gold is typically thought about to be a safe investment and a hedge versus inflation because the rate of the metal goes up when the U.S. dollar goes down. Something financiers need to consider is that a lot of 401( k) retirement strategies do not permit for the direct ownership of physical gold or gold derivatives such as futures or alternatives agreements. rollover 401k to gold ira. Nevertheless, there are some indirect ways to get your hands on some gold in your 401( k).



However, gold IRAs do exist that specialize in holding valuable metals for retirement cost savings. Financiers can nonetheless find specific shared funds or ETFs that hold gold or gold mining stocks through their 401( k) s. Rolling over a 401( k) to a self-directed IRA might offer financiers greater access to more diverse kinds of investment in gold. switching from 401k to gold ira rollover. A 401( k) plan is a self-directed employer-sponsored retirement cost savings plan. Used by numerous companies, millions of Americans rely on these tax-advantaged investment plans to assist them live out their retirement years easily. People can divert part of their salary on a pretax basis toward long-term financial investments, with many employers using to make partial or perhaps 100% matching contributions to the cash purchased the plan by workers.
